ConfigMap

Nilai boolean konfigurasi kubernetes

Nilai boolean konfigurasi kubernetes
  1. Apakah mungkin untuk memasang rahasia ke pod benar atau salah?
  2. Bagaimana Anda menulis ConfigMap di Kubernetes?
  3. Apakah ConfigMap hanya dibaca?
  4. Apa perbedaan antara configmaps dan rahasia?
  5. Apa perbedaan antara rahasia dan configmaps?
  6. Mengapa Tidak Menggunakan Rahasia Kubernetes?
  7. Bisakah Anda menulis ke ConfigMap?
  8. Berapa batas ukuran configmap?
  9. Dapatkah Anda menambahkan file ke configMap?
  10. Bagaimana cara memeriksa configmap saya di Kubectl?
  11. Bagaimana cara mendapatkan jalur KubeConfig?
  12. Bagaimana cara mendapatkan detail pod di Kubectl?
  13. Bisakah Anda menulis ke ConfigMap?
  14. Adalah configmap a namespace?
  15. Berapa batas ukuran configmap?

Apakah mungkin untuk memasang rahasia ke pod benar atau salah?

Rahasia dapat dipasang sebagai volume data atau diekspos sebagai variabel lingkungan yang akan digunakan oleh wadah dalam pod.

Bagaimana Anda menulis ConfigMap di Kubernetes?

Cara paling sederhana untuk membuat ConfigMap adalah dengan menyimpan banyak string nilai kunci dalam file YAML configMap dan menyuntikkannya sebagai variabel lingkungan ke dalam pod Anda. Setelah itu, Anda dapat merujuk variabel lingkungan dalam aplikasi Anda menggunakan metode apa pun yang diperlukan untuk bahasa pemrograman Anda.

Apakah ConfigMap hanya dibaca?

Configmaps selalu dipasang baca saja. Jika Anda perlu memodifikasi ConfigMap di pod, Anda harus menyalinnya dari pemasangan configMap ke file biasa di pod dan kemudian memodifikasinya.

Apa perbedaan antara configmaps dan rahasia?

Perbedaan utama antara ConfigMaps dan Secrets adalah kerahasiaan data yang terkandung di dalamnya. Rahasia Mengaburkan Data dengan Pengkodean Base64, sedangkan data ConfigMaps dalam teks biasa. Perhatikan bahwa kami juga dapat menyimpan teks biasa di ConfigMaps sebagai string yang dikodekan Base64.

Apa perbedaan antara rahasia dan configmaps?

Baik ConfigMaps dan Secrets menyimpan data dengan cara yang sama, dengan pasangan kunci/nilai, tetapi configMaps dimaksudkan untuk data teks biasa, dan rahasia dimaksudkan untuk data yang tidak ingin Anda ketahui atau siapa pun untuk mengetahui kecuali aplikasi tersebut.

Mengapa Tidak Menggunakan Rahasia Kubernetes?

Data rahasia Kubernetes dikodekan dalam format base64 dan disimpan sebagai teks biasa di etcd. ETCD adalah toko value kunci yang digunakan sebagai toko dukungan untuk keadaan kluster kubernetes dan data konfigurasi. Menyimpan rahasia sebagai teks polos di etcd berisiko, karena dapat dengan mudah dikompromikan oleh penyerang dan digunakan untuk mengakses sistem.

Bisakah Anda menulis ke ConfigMap?

Anda dapat menulis spec pod yang mengacu pada configMap dan mengkonfigurasi wadah di pod itu berdasarkan data di ConfigMap. Pod dan ConfigMap harus berada di namespace yang sama. CATATAN: Spesifikasi pod statis tidak dapat merujuk ke ConfigMap atau objek API lainnya.

Berapa batas ukuran configmap?

Batas ukuran konfigurasi

ConfigMap tidak dirancang untuk menampung potongan data yang besar. Data yang disimpan dalam configMap tidak dapat melebihi 1 mib. Jika Anda perlu menyimpan pengaturan yang lebih besar dari batas ini, Anda mungkin ingin mempertimbangkan pemasangan volume atau menggunakan database atau layanan file terpisah.

Dapatkah Anda menambahkan file ke configMap?

Anda dapat membuat ConfigMap dari file, direktori, dan nilai literal. Bergantung pada sumbernya, atributnya akan:--From file (jika sumbernya adalah file/direktori) ---From-literal (jika sumbernya adalah pasangan nilai kunci)

Bagaimana cara memeriksa configmap saya di Kubectl?

Isi ConfigMap dapat dilihat dengan perintah Kubectl menjelaskan. Perhatikan bahwa konten lengkap file terlihat dan bahwa nama kunci, pada kenyataannya, nama file, max_allowed_packet. CNF. ConfigMap dapat diedit secara langsung di dalam Kubernetes dengan perintah edit Kubectl.

Bagaimana cara mendapatkan jalur KubeConfig?

Kubeconfig. Untuk mengakses kluster Kubernetes Anda, Kubectl menggunakan file konfigurasi. File konfigurasi Kubectl default terletak di ~/. Kube/config dan disebut sebagai file KubeConfig.

Bagaimana cara mendapatkan detail pod di Kubectl?

Anda dapat melihat pod pada cluster Anda menggunakan perintah KUBECTL GET PODS. Tambahkan -namespace <Nama Namespace> Bendera Jika polong Anda berjalan di luar namespace default. Anda juga dapat menggunakan label untuk memfilter hasil sesuai kebutuhan dengan menambahkan <label saya>=<Nilai saya> .

Bisakah Anda menulis ke ConfigMap?

Anda dapat menulis spec pod yang mengacu pada configMap dan mengkonfigurasi wadah di pod itu berdasarkan data di ConfigMap. Pod dan ConfigMap harus berada di namespace yang sama. CATATAN: Spesifikasi pod statis tidak dapat merujuk ke ConfigMap atau objek API lainnya.

Adalah configmap a namespace?

ConfigMaps berada di namespace dan hanya polong yang berada di namespace yang sama yang dapat merujuknya. ConfigMaps tidak dapat digunakan untuk pod statis.

Berapa batas ukuran configmap?

Batas ukuran konfigurasi

ConfigMap tidak dirancang untuk menampung potongan data yang besar. Data yang disimpan dalam configMap tidak dapat melebihi 1 mib. Jika Anda perlu menyimpan pengaturan yang lebih besar dari batas ini, Anda mungkin ingin mempertimbangkan pemasangan volume atau menggunakan database atau layanan file terpisah.

Buruh pelabuhan.Inti.HttpBadResponseException {message 2 kesalahan terjadi \ n \ t* penyediaan Docker Distro WSL Deploying
Bagaimana cara memperbaiki wsl2 menginstal tidak lengkap di docker?Cara mengaktifkan wsl2 di desktop docker? Bagaimana cara memperbaiki wsl2 mengins...
Ansible / jinja2 kesalahan tipe templating yang tidak terduga
Apa itu Template Jinja2?Apa template di ansible?Apa perbedaan antara Jinja dan Jinja2?Mengapa itu disebut jinja2?Untuk apa templat jinja digunakan?Ap...
Masalah saat membuat set replika
Pertimbangan mana yang pantas dipikirkan saat merancang arsitektur set replika?Apakah replika sepadan?Apa yang membuat replika bagus?Apakah penyebara...